MEMO TO THE BOARD — Headcount Plan

Vexlor Industries proposes 42 net new roles next year: 18 in engineering, 12 in field operations, and the remainder across support functions. Attrition assumptions hold at 9%. The Marleth office absorbs most growth; Dunmore stays flat. Payroll impact is within the approved envelope. The rationale depends on plans summarized below.

confidential, yahip-hagug: Gorixax Logistics plans to lower the Ulaael list price by 26.6 percent in October. The pricing group signed off on a budget of $199.9 million for Project Holix. The renewal with Kasdorox Systems closes at $137.5 million a year, 8.2 percent above the last contract. Project Lamion slips by a full year because of the audit delay.

### Step 4: Normalize Build Agent Clocks

Before migrating to Forgelane 3, verify clock skew across all agents in the Tindervale pool. Skew above 500ms invalidates artifact signatures and breaks provenance checks. Run the skew audit, quarantine any agent failing twice, and re-enroll it only after NTP sync confirms. Signature validation will hard-fail post-migration, so do this first. The skew daemon must be started with the following configuration.

deployment values, yadug-bawif:
[framir]
team = pelox
access_code = ac_a38ab2
owner = tamion.julael
host = framir.tolvaqlabs.test
port = 11211
peer = tammir.zemvargrid.local
salt = 2215ef03
pin = 1541

Hi Marek — handing over the Flourline queue. One open item: the order-cutoff rule for Petal & Crumb bakery changed this week. Orders now lock at 14:00 local, not 16:00, and the scheduler still shows the old time in two views, so customers will claim they ordered "before cutoff." Check the order timestamp against the new rule before issuing credits, and log every exception in the handover sheet. If the scheduler discrepancy resurfaces, loop in the Petal & Crumb integrations contact at the address below.

escalation mailbox, bafog-fafog: ulador@paliqlabs.internal

**Changelog — InkmillRender v3.8.2**

Heads up, support folks: we rotated the signing key for the Inkmill markdown rendering pipeline this week. Old previews cached before Tuesday may show a stale-signature banner — just tell users to hard-refresh. The renderer itself hasn't changed, so formatting bugs are not related to this rotation. Builds signed with the old key stop validating next Friday. If anyone asks which key is now live, it's the one below.

rollout seal: bky4_x7Gc